Berlin Intermediate is a middle school located in Berlin, Maryland. The school serves 640 students in grades 5-6.
With a DataScore of 55/100 (C), Berlin Intermediate performs at the state average for Maryland. Notably, the school is on an upward trend, showing meaningful improvement over the past three years.
50% of students q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, which is factored into the resource access component of the DataScore.
